Understanding Hawaiian Cannabis Heritage

Hawaii’s tropical climate provides the perfect environment for cultivating high-quality cannabis. Kona Gold and Maui Wowie have been developed over decades, becoming symbols of the Hawaiian cannabis culture. While both strains originate from the islands, their characteristics and effects cater to different preferences.

Kona Gold: The Uplifting Powerhouse

Origins and Genetics

Kona Gold is a pure sativa that, according to legend (and varies by location in Kona) originated from seed brought in from Acapulco in Mexico and also Thailand cultivars. The Kona region of Hawaii’s Big Island has both low hot areas as well as rainforest uplands; sativa strains do well in both locations. The Acapulco varieties do better (to begin with as new introductions) in the hot, lowlands in Kona; the Thailand varieties do well in highland moist areas. The two strains merged over time, and the surviving Sativa that Hawaii Premium Seed has is a combination, known as Thai Kona Gold. This strain is known for its high potency and invigorating effects, making it a favorite among those seeking an energetic boost and exceedingly potent flowers.

Maui Wowie: The Relaxing Tropical Escape

Origins and Genetics

Maui Wowie is another legendary Hawaiian strain, developed on the island of Maui. Unlike Kona Gold, which is a pure sativa, Maui Wowie is a sativa-dominant hybrid, known for its relaxing yet mentally stimulating effects. The term Maui Wowie was popularized in the 1970s when tons of high quality weed was grown with practically no limits and shipped all over the world. Depending upon the area of Maui, the genetic history of the strain varied a lot. The variety that I know of, and grew in the Hana area of Maui in 1977 to 1980 was reportedly a cross between Panama Red, Colombian, and Thai. Those landrace strains were hybridized during the 1960s and then a guy named Matt brought in seed from the Hindu-Kush region (pure Indica) to include in the mix. The result was a vigorous, tall plant with mostly sativa phenotypes (tall and strong) but with Indica traits as well (colas as long and thick as a human arm, commonly referred to as “donkey dongs”). Indeed, when I saw my first mature marijuana plant in Ulupalakua on the slopes of Haleakala I did not recognize it, as it stood about 12 feet tall and looked more like a Saguaro cactus, with the long, thick “donkey dong” colas.
